Bank Statements and Transaction Logs as Core Evidence
Bank statements are foundational ("bank statements as proof unauthorized withdrawal dispute"). Highlight the charge, date, merchant, and amount. Request full logs showing IP address, device ID, or geolocation--crucial for online fraud ("IP logs evidence in online unauthorized transaction dispute").
Example: If your US account shows a charge from Nigeria IP, screenshot it.

Step-by-Step Guide: How to Gather and Submit Proof for Your Dispute
- Review statements: Identify unauthorized charges immediately.
- Contact bank: Report verbally, get confirmation number.
- Gather docs: Statements, IDs, affidavits.
- File police report if >$500 ("police report for disputing fraudulent bank transaction").
- Collect digital proof: Screenshots of unfamiliar IPs/devices.
- Document 2FA: Logs of failed codes ("two-factor authentication failure as dispute proof").
- Submit dispute: Online/app/letter within timelines ("gathering evidence for credit card fraud dispute").
- Follow up: Track status every 10 days ("timeline for providing proof in unauthorized dispute claim").
- Respond to merchant: Counter their evidence.
- Appeal if denied: Add forensics/police report.
- Escalate: CFPB, FCA, or Visa/MC arbitration.

ACH Transfers and Electronic Payments
For ACH ("dispute process unauthorized ACH transfer proof"), prove via statements + affidavit. Banks must investigate within 10 days.
